Patna: Tej Pratap Yadav, senior leader and former Bihar minister, launched a sharp verbal attack on his brother, RJD MLA Bhai Virendra, on Friday, accusing him of threatening law and order in the state. Speaking to reporters in Patna, Tej Pratap described Virendra as a “goon” and “rowdy” and demanded strict government action against him.
The remarks come after an incident at a polling booth in Maner on Thursday, in which Bhai Virendra allegedly abused a police inspector and threatened to set him on fire. An FIR has been filed in connection with the incident.
“Action should be taken against him, whether he is an RJD leader or a member of any other party,” Tej Pratap said. “These people have ruined Bihar. They are goons and rowdies. They even beat up Dalits. The government must take cognisance and act against them.”
This is not the first time Tej Pratap has publicly reprimanded his brother. Earlier this year, he condemned Virendra for allegedly mistreating a Panchayat Secretary in Champaran, an incident captured in a viral audio clip. A case was filed at the SC/ST police station at the time, and a fresh FIR has now been lodged following Thursday’s altercation.
